Mission  
School mission: Arizona State University at the West campus, a community-focused metropolitan campus of ASU, engages in discovering and advancing knowledge, teaching diverse students in a student-centered, interdisciplinary learning environment, and serving the community. ASU West is committed to developing a learning community that addresses the needs of a diverse metropolitan environment. ASU West does this by: offering learner-centered academic programs that enhance learning through teaching, service and enrichment opportunities; promoting discovery and innovation; pursuing new knowledge; introducing insights and creative ideas through instruction; encouraging direct involvement in new fields of inquiry; investigating important community-based issues; and integrating with the community through service.
